Transaction 177e75919d7b8019d6b61ac21fb3a36eea46d3d4d156b5d0e982995ebd24d2c6
2 Input
2 Outputs
- 177e75919d7b8019d6b61ac21fb3a36eea46d3d4d156b5d0e982995ebd24d2c6:0
- 177e75919d7b8019d6b61ac21fb3a36eea46d3d4d156b5d0e982995ebd24d2c6:1
value 6130000
address 1BWDndB7t98tW4QasZDpFCmVbdZ8armzJB
value 635772
address 3JZPiwmURAnEJZ1MWLBW7mFazQmtkeAeEk